Social media integration

Social media is an essential aspect of marketing. Most brands leverage this medium and build marketing campaigns around it. The best part of social media is you can also do it for free or at a little cost.

The best way to integrate social media is to include social share and follow buttons on your travel website. Visitors can then share your content with ease if they like it. For example, if you place an offer on flights to a specific destination, visitors could share this on social media which brings even more traffic to your website.

You should also consider providing users with social login. According to studies, 73% of the users on the internet prefer signing in to a website using their social logins. It saves them the time to create a new account, increasing stickiness and repeat visitors to your website. You should also plan to leverage this data to design personalised marketing campaigns to target these users.

Design tools

Design is paramount to any digital marketing campaign. Compelling designs make it easy to lure your visitors into acting on your campaign.  If you feel confident on design, you can use these design tools online. You don’t have to have any previous experience with graphic design to use them.

Canva

We’ve added a Canva is a user-friendly graphic design tool which helps bloggers, digital marketers, businesses and other professionals create eye-catching designs without any graphic design experience. The online graphic design tool has several features which are simple to use. Some prominent feature includes quality images, illustrations, templates and fonts.

While you can do most of the things for free on Canva, you can also go for a paid account which opens a wide array of features, and it will cost you just $9.95 per month when paid annually or $12.95 paid monthly.

 

 

Stencil

Stencil is one of the best and fastest ways to improve your engagement on social media. Stencil grants you access to some of the most exquisite photos and quotes which could help you better your business. The design tool allows you to create compelling designs and it is simple-to-learn and easy-to-use. Some of its main features include breathtaking templates, background photos, upload and store logos, quotes, upload fonts, Google web fonts, easy customisation and icons and graphics.

Stencil has a free account but if you are looking for more it will cost you $9 a month of paid annually for a pro membership where you can create 50 images a month and if you need more than that you can opt for the unlimited membership which you cost you as less as $12 a month if paid annually.

MailChimp

MailChimp has inbuilt tools that help you collect leads, create emails, and send them out. The E-mail tool even has a mobile app to help you craft and send out marketing campaigns from an Android or iOS device. MailChimp is easy to use, and it will cost you nothing if you want to give it a try. However, their paid services start from $10 a month.

 

 

GetResponse

GetResponse is another popular tool for designing and sending HTML e-newsletters. This tool helps you import and host a mailing list while capturing data onto it. You can create customised e-newsletters which can be quickly sent to the subscribers on your mailing list. Your e-mails can be automated, and you can also analyse statistics regarding your email marketing campaigns.

Moovly

Moovly is one of the best platforms online to create an animated video with infographics. This online video editor has some brilliant features that will help your Travel agency website stand out from the rest. You can use sounds, music, animation, and real photos or video to make animated infographic video, display ads – both banner and skyscraper ads, presentations, e-cards and everything else.

Moovly is free to use, but it provides limited features. However, if you want more, you could go for the paid services for just $5 per month.

 

Animoto

As a travel agency website, you might be looking at making a photo-based video to entice your audience with breathtaking locations. This is where Animoto could be a useful tool. If you are not looking for anything fancy, you can merely put images together and create a simple yet elegant slideshow. However, if want more and decide to create proper marketing video, Animoto offers different aspect ratios especially keeping social platforms in mind and set templates that could help promote your business.

What if you are considering outsourcing it to an agency?

 

Outsourcing does often save time and effort. You can also get a professional’s point of view on what is needed and how to get it done.  However, it is not going to be cheap. The cost of outsourcing a travel agency website would be in the range of $2000 – $5000 with simple functionality.  However, if you are looking for a website with advanced features, be ready to fork out up to $30,000.

This is a massive one-time payment so think wisely before you invest because it is difficult to back out once the money is spent. Apart from the cost, once the website is built and additional changes have to be made, keep in mind you will have to bear further costs. Building these website does take time to give yourself a few months time. An agency may also take anywhere between 2 to 6 months to build your website.
